As winter descends on much of North America, the Coast-to-Coast EVs crew unpacks cold weather EV charging and DC fast charging site standards.
From the frozen woes at Tesla Superchargers and other sites in Chicagoland to rental and rideshare drivers exacerbating slow charging sessions, we try to separate the facts from the inevitable sensationalism that such scenarios breed. Our returning guest Darren Orange brings some data and an experienced Tesla driver's perspective to contextualize the hyperbolic headlines.
After warming up with winter topics, we shift to setting higher standards for DC fast charging. Special guest Candice Jurick speaks to the consideration of charging station safety and accessibility, especially in remote and rural areas, while Walter talks about using Eric's site review template (NCSRM = News Coulomb Site Review Model) to grade some of the latest Pilot-Flying J charging stations.
